COMMUNITY NEWS

  • Rescue Mission of the Mahoning Valley is busy getting ready for Thanksgiving by offering a buffet meal in two sessions to its 174 residents and others in need. President John Muckridge (head of the mission) said they are working with local agencies to handle extra demand and plan to increase capacity from 186 to 354 beds (adding 12 new homes) using community donations.  WKBN
  • Greenwood Chevrolet donated food items and a $25,000 check to Second Harvest Food Bank on Monday in its showroom—three trucks filled with community donations from the Extra Mile Food Drive that ran from October 13 through November 20 will help provide over 130,000 meals for the holiday season.  WKBN
  • Two Youngstown brothers, aged 7 and 9, turned a swear jar idea into nearly $100 for the Rescue Mission of the Mahoning Valley. The Philliban family delivered the donation to the shelter & saw firsthand how it would help provide meals and safe shelter for those in need.  WFMJ
  • Local organizations are accepting donations to help about 140 residents displaced by the Phoenix House explosion in Austintown. United Way is asking for monetary donations while the Austintown Senior Center, Lakeside Realty and Animal Charity of Ohio collect clothing, toiletries and pet supplies—items needed through the end of this week.  WKBN
  • West Century 21 Lakeside Realty in Austintown is accepting clothing, toiletries and basic essentials donations to support Phoenix House residents affected by the apartment explosion. Donations may be dropped off (253 S Canfield-Niles Road, Suite A).  WKBN

EDUCATION NEWS

  • Craig Hockenberry—superintendent of the Poland Local School District—will begin a medical leave on December 1 to treat his esophageal cancer and plans to retire on August 31. The board named acting deputy superintendent Maria Hoffmaster to lead the district until an interim superintendent is chosen.  The Vindicator

GOVERNMENT NEWS

  • The Trumbull Neighborhood Partnership was approved for $712,190 in grant funds for its Emergency Home Repair Program, which will help at least 40 income-qualifying homeowners fix roofs, HVAC systems, and improve handicap accessibility—part of efforts that have supported over $895 million in affordable housing since 1990.  WKBN
  • Norfolk Southern, the state and Youngstown State University revived plans for a $20 million first responder training center near East Palestine after the worst derailment in a decade. The center will help train firefighters and first responders for emergencies—offering free access to local responders and supporting recovery efforts.  WFMJ

SPORTS NEWS

  • Browns legend Bernie Kosar is expected to be released from the hospital later today after he received a liver transplant last Monday at University Hospitals—he has been saying he feels 'amazing' since the surgery—and his family thanked the donor for helping his recovery.  WKBN
